About James C. Ross

James C. Ross is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Oncology, having authored 95 papers that have together received 3.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(33 papers),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(13 papers), Pulmonary Hypertension Research and Treatments (9 papers),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(8 papers),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(6 papers), Medical Image Segmentation Techniques (5 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(4 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(1.8k citations), Health Informatics (23 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(340 citations),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(58 citations) and Obstetrics and Gynecology (84 citations). James C. Ross has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Chile and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Raúl San Jośe Estépar, George R. Washko, Alejandro A. Díaz, Edwin K. Silverman, Hiroto Hatabu, Iván O. Rosas, Gary M. Hunninghake, David A. Lynch, Tsuneo Yamashiro and Farbod N. Rahaghi. Their work appears in journals such as Academic Radiology, CHEST Journal, American Journal of Respiratory and Critical Care Medicine, Respiratory Research and Annals of the American Thoracic Society.
